From: Stefan Agner stefan.agner@toradex.com
Add support for distro boot. This is especially helpful for external devices. There is a global boot command which scans a predefined list of boot targets: run distro_bootcmd
As well as direct boot commands such as: run bootcmd_mmc1 run bootcmd_usb run bootcmd_dhcp ...
Refer to doc/README.distro fo details.
While at it, remove the CONFIG_DRIVE_TYPES define which has not been used and was meant to be used for multi device boot support which is now provided by distroboot.

From: Max Krummenacher max.krummenacher@toradex.com
If the UART is used in DTE mode the RI and DCD bits in UCR3 become irq enable bits. Both are set to enabled after reset and both likely are pending.
Disable the bits also on UARTs not used in the boot loader to prevent an interrupt storm when Linux enables the UART interrupts.

From: Max Krummenacher max.krummenacher@toradex.com
We have two commands to change the bootmode fuses: mfgr_fuse which set fuse 0/5 and 0/6 and updt_fuse which burns bit 4 of 0/5.
Before Image 2.6 we fused in mfgr_fuse 0x5062, which boots from the user partition of the eMMC. To workaround certain hangs we moved to fastboot mode and using the first bootpartition of the eMMC requiring a fuse value of 0x5072 which could be achived by the then added updt_fuse command. At the same time the mfgr_fuse command was changed to also fuse 0x5072, revert that second change so that one can fuse both values, one with just mfgr_fuse and the later with mfgr_fuse;updt_fuse.
Note that the mfgr_fuse command is only needed at module production time, a customer might need to use updt_fuse when upgrading an older module to be compatible with a newer image. The command is integrated into the image update scripts.

From: Gerard Salvatella gerard.salvatella@toradex.com
RGMII_RD1 pin (active high, GPIO6_IO27) is triggered on reboot during the SPL phase. This asserts (active low) nReset_Out from the PMIC. Only V1.1 and later Colibri iMX6 modules implement this in hw. Previous versions do not use this pin, so it is safe to leave it enabled at all times.

From: Gerard Salvatella gerard.salvatella@toradex.com
The PMIC on the Colibri iMX6 may have ECC errors in fuses that will prevent correct settings. Up to one bit error per fuse bank can be reported and corrected by the ECC logic. Two bit errors can only be reported.
